Kemet Corp. (KEM) Thursday said it still anticipates fourth-quarter revenue of between $205 million and $210 million, lower than last year's $261.5 million. Analysts' consensus currently sees revenues of $205.60 million. Fourth-quarter results may be expected May 10, 2012.
Further, the company forecast adjusted EBITDA for the year ending March 31, 2012 in the range of $128 million to $132 million. For fiscal 2011, Kemet had reported adjusted EBITDA of $196.1 million.
